Transaction 1972b026351908fde2c8a8029b80598b481dc5d78fb0efa1e1668a0cec705697
1 Input
1 Output
-
1972b026351908fde2c8a8029b80598b481dc5d78fb0efa1e1668a0cec705697:0
- value
- 579530
- script pubkey
- OP_0 OP_PUSHBYTES_20 5289716609e373f9d15d2afc234692d299ef53fd
- address
- bc1q22yhzesfudeln52a9t7zx35j62v775la7a9dxz